Suzette Cabrales Hernandez
Major: Management
Expected Graduation: Summer 2026
Hometown: Wichita, Kansas
Suzette Cabrales Hernandez is a business management major whose path is defined by ambition and curiosity. A member of the Widener Global Leaders Program, she values the Barton School’s emphasis on mentorship, applied learning, and connection.
Suzette’s most meaningful experiences have come from engaging with diverse perspectives both inside and outside the classroom. Through Barton’s programs and community service opportunities, she has learned lessons that go beyond academics. She appreciates mentors who remind students that making mistakes is part of learning and that personal growth is as important as professional achievement.
Her academic journey reflects a deep appreciation for both business and psychology. After graduation, Suzette plans to pursue graduate studies abroad, earning a master’s degree in marketing and design, followed by a second master’s in either Psychology or Industrial-Organizational Psychology. Ultimately, she hopes to combine these disciplines in a career that explores how creativity and behavior shape organizational success.
Suzette’s time in the Barton School has included involvement in community service, leadership programs, and cultural engagement activities. She is ambidextrous, a small detail that reflects her adaptability and fluid way of thinking.
Her inspiration comes from her time living in France, where she discovered how much she enjoys learning from other cultures and perspectives. That experience reaffirmed her love for travel and the pursuit of continuous learning.
Suzette chose business management because she grew up surrounded by family entrepreneurs and admired their independence and drive. Books like Rich Dad Poor Dad and the influence of her family helped her see business as a path of empowerment and possibility.
